1. Temporal Localization of Representations in Recurrent Neural Networks
University essay from Högskolan Dalarna/Institutionen för information och teknikAbstract : Recurrent Neural Networks (RNNs) are pivotal in deep learning for time series prediction, but they suffer from 'exploding values' and 'gradient decay,' particularly when learning temporally distant interactions. Long Short-Term Memory (LSTM) and Gated Recurrent Units (GRU) have addressed these issues to an extent, but the precise mitigating mechanisms remain unclear. READ MORE

3. Perception accuracy and user acceptance of legend designs for opacity data mapping in GIS
University essay from Lunds universitet/Institutionen för naturgeografi och ekosystemvetenskapAbstract : In a GIS system, the need to encode geospatial data without standardized cartographic representations, such as population data, weather information, etc., on top of a map is common. This can be done with a layer on top of a base map, with the effect that the base map is partially or fully hidden. READ MORE

4. Adapting the PIC/FLIP fluid simulation method to produce a LEGO water animation & evaluating its performance
University essay from KTH/Skolan för elektroteknik och datavetenskap (EECS)Abstract : Fluid simulation in computer graphics is a well-researched field used to simulate water in different ways. Although computer graphics techniques in this area usually aim towards creating realistic representations, they can also deviate to create stylized animations of water that adopt different aesthetics whilst maintaining certain aspects of realism.
